Taking the train from Barnsley to Chapel-en-le-Frith in 1 hour 56 minutes

Thinking about taking the train from Barnsley to Chapel-en-le-Frith? We've got you covered.

It usually takes around 1 hour 59 minutes to travel the 25 miles (40 km) from Barnsley to Chapel-en-le-Frith by train, although you can get there in as little as 1 hour 56 minutes on the fastest services. You'll normally find around 10 trains per day running on this route. You'll need to make 2 changes along the way as there aren't any direct services on this line. During your journey, you'll either be travelling with East Midlands Railway or TransPennine Express, as they are the main operators of services on this route.

Cheap train tickets from Barnsley to Chapel-en-le-Frith

Book in advance

Look out for Advance tickets – they usually come out up to 12 weeks before the departure date and can be cheaper than buying on the day. If you’re here a tad early, sign up for our Advance ticket alert today to get notified when your tickets are released.

Consider a Season Ticket

If you catch this train more than 3 times per week, you could save money with a Season Ticket. With annual, monthly and weekly options available, find out if a season ticket for Barnsley to Chapel-en-le-Frith is right for you.

Use your Railcard

National Railcards offer a 1/3 off eligible train tickets in the UK and can be a great investment if you travel a few times or more in a year. Find out how you can save with a National Railcard here.
